Arelion study reveals shrinking confidence in network investment decisions

June 14, 2024
The report explores factors affecting the choices made by enterprise network decision-makers.

A recent Arelion report reveals that confidence in network investment decisions is fading.

The report, “Doubt, delay and regret: How global disruptors are impacting enterprise networks,” purports that 87 percent of network decision-makers are “a little or a lot less confident” in the network investment decisions that they make, a trend Arelion chalks up to macroeconomic disruption.

The study, conducted by Savanta in the first half of 2024, questioned 545 industry representatives in the United States, the United Kingdom, France, and Germany about the key disruptive forces that have impacted their networks in recent years.

Arelion says enterprise decision-makers report technological change, rising costs, and climate change as the most disruptive influences on network decisions.

Mattias Fridström, Chief Evangelist at Arelion, said in a press release, “The findings of our research suggest that, over the last three years, enterprise network decision-makers are reeling from the effects of excessive change and disruption. They admit they’re feeling the heat.”

Fridström reported that almost half of decision-makers regret networking decisions they’ve made in the past.

The report also revealed decision-makers’ feelings towards AI: 92 percent plan to use AI-based tools and systems to support network management within the next 18 months, half of which will do so within six months.

The chief use of AI, according to respondents, will likely be security. Leaders responded that DDoS attacks and sponsored cyber-attacks concern them most.
